Arborist Pruning in Reno, NV
Arborist pruning services involve the careful trimming and shaping of trees to promote healthy growth, improve appearance, and ensure safety around a property. These services typically include removing dead or diseased branches, reducing the risk of storm damage, and maintaining the overall structure of trees. Projects can range from routine maintenance to more complex crown thinning or shaping, helping to enhance the aesthetic appeal of a landscape while supporting the long-term health of the trees.
Property owners interested in arborist pruning should consider factors such as the age and species of their trees, the goals for their landscape, and any safety concerns related to overgrown or damaged branches. It’s important to understand the scope of pruning needed, whether for aesthetic reasons, safety, or health, and to communicate these priorities clearly when requesting services. Proper pruning can also prevent future problems and extend the lifespan of trees on the property.

Common Arborist Pruning Jobs
Tree thinning - reduces the density of branches to improve tree health and airflow.
Structural pruning - shapes trees for better stability and aesthetic appeal.
Deadwood removal - eliminates dead or diseased branches to prevent potential hazards.
Formative pruning - guides young trees to develop strong, healthy growth patterns.
Crown reduction - decreases the size of the tree's canopy to prevent overgrowth and property interference.
Storm damage pruning - clears broken or damaged branches after severe weather events.
Arborist Pruning Questions
What is arborist pruning? Arborist pruning involves selectively trimming and shaping trees to promote healthy growth and maintain safety on the property.
Why is pruning important for trees? Proper pruning helps prevent disease, removes dead or hazardous branches, and enhances the tree's overall appearance.
What types of pruning services are available? Services include crown thinning, crown reduction, deadwood removal, and structural pruning to improve tree stability.
When is the best time for pruning? The ideal time for pruning varies by tree species, but generally during late winter or early spring before new growth begins.
